Kashi - Kashi protein cereal has a average-calorie, average-carb, low-fat and high-protein content.
With 13 gms of protein, it is high in protein content, which is an important macronutrient that helps with tissue repair, provides energy and improves immunity.
Because of its low fat content, it could be suitable option, especially if you're watching your fat intake for health reasons.
Ideally consumed as a Breakfast.
